Everyday hustle in Nigeria be difficult , and many people dey try to earn a living. But the influx of copyright, also known as duplicates, dey turn this hustle into a struggle.
These products range from electronics and clothing to beauty products. Some Nigerians wey don buy these copyright, dem later realize say dem no dey work properly. This na why many people dey plead for a fix.
The government dey try to tackle this problem by enforcing stricter laws against the sale of copyright. But, the business still dey flourish underground.
Many factors contribute to the prevalence of copyright in Nigeria, including:
- High demand for cheap products
- Weak law enforcement
- Corruption
This na a multifaceted issue wey need a multi-pronged approach to solve. We need to work together as a nation to eradicate this menace.

Nigerian Market Deception: Beware of Counterfeits
Bros and Sis, let me tell you something about the Naija market. It's a place where you can find anything your heart desires, from genuine goods to some straight-up copyright items. You need to be very careful when you are shopping here because there are lots of people trying to scam innocent customers. Make sure you always check the condition of a product before you buy it. Don't just trust what the seller tells you, do your own investigation. And if something seems too good to be true, it probably is.
- Always check different vendors for the same product.
- Examine carefully the labels of the goods.
- If possible, demand to see a receipt or warranty from the seller.
Stay sharp and don't let anyone con you. The market is full of scammers, but if you know what to look for, you can avoid them and get a good deal on your purchases.
